use anyhow::Result;
use plotters::prelude::*;
pub fn plot(name: &str, rng_fn: &mut dyn FnMut() -> f64, n: usize, path: &str) -> Result<()> {
let root = BitMapBackend::new(path, (640, 640)).into_drawing_area();
root.fill(&WHITE)?;
let mut chart = ChartBuilder::on(&root)
.caption(name, ("sans-serif", 18).into_font())
.margin(20)
.x_label_area_size(30)
.y_label_area_size(30)
.build_cartesian_2d(0f64..1f64, 0f64..1f64)?;
chart
.configure_mesh()
.x_labels(5)
.y_labels(5)
.disable_mesh()
.draw()?;
let mut points = Vec::with_capacity(n);
let mut prev = rng_fn();
for _ in 0..n {
let cur = rng_fn();
points.push((prev, cur));
prev = cur;
}
chart
.draw_series(
points
.iter()
.map(|&(x, y)| Circle::new((x, y), 1, RGBColor(60, 120, 200).filled())),
)?
.label(name)
.legend(|(x, y)| Circle::new((x, y), 4, RGBColor(60, 120, 200).filled()));
root.present()?;
println!(" scatter → {}", path);
Ok(())
}
